How they compare

Belgium currently reports 1.8% against 1.6% in Latvia, a difference of 0.2%.

That makes Belgium's figure about 1.1 times Latvia's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 21 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Latvia ahead.

Belgium ranks 25th and Latvia ranks 28th of 38 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Belgium averaged higher in 1 and Latvia in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Belgium Latvia Difference Ahead
2000s 2.9% 3.9% 1.0% Latvia
2010s 3.2% 3.9% 0.7% Latvia
2020s 1.9% 1.5% 0.4% Belgium

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
